当前位置: X-MOL 学术arXiv.cs.DB › 论文详情
Our official English website, www.x-mol.net, welcomes your feedback! (Note: you will need to create a separate account there.)
When is Ontology-Mediated Querying Efficient?
arXiv - CS - Databases Pub Date : 2020-03-17 , DOI: arxiv-2003.07800
Pablo Barcelo, Cristina Feier, Carsten Lutz, Andreas Pieris

In ontology-mediated querying, description logic (DL) ontologies are used to enrich incomplete data with domain knowledge which results in more complete answers to queries. However, the evaluation of ontology-mediated queries (OMQs) over relational databases is computationally hard. This raises the question when OMQ evaluation is efficient, in the sense of being tractable in combined complexity or fixed-parameter tractable. We study this question for a range of ontology-mediated query languages based on several important and widely-used DLs, using unions of conjunctive queries as the actual queries. For the DL ELHI extended with the bottom concept, we provide a characterization of the classes of OMQs that are fixed-parameter tractable. For its fragment EL extended with domain and range restrictions and the bottom concept (which restricts the use of inverse roles), we provide a characterization of the classes of OMQs that are tractable in combined complexity. Both results are in terms of equivalence to OMQs of bounded tree width and rest on a reasonable assumption from parameterized complexity theory. They are similar in spirit to Grohe's seminal characterization of the tractable classes of conjunctive queries over relational databases. We further study the complexity of the meta problem of deciding whether a given OMQ is equivalent to an OMQ of bounded tree width, providing several completeness results that range from NP to 2ExpTime, depending on the DL used. We also consider the DL-Lite family of DLs, including members that admit functional roles.

中文翻译:

Ontology-Mediated Query 何时有效?

在本体介导的查询中,描述逻辑 (DL) 本体用于用领域知识丰富不完整的数据,从而为查询提供更完整的答案。然而,对关系数据库的本体中介查询 (OMQ) 的评估在计算上是困难的。这提出了一个问题,即 OMQ 评估何时有效,即在组合复杂性中易于处理或固定参数可处理。我们针对一系列基于几个重要且广泛使用的 DL 的本体介导的查询语言研究了这个问题,使用联合查询的并集作为实际查询。对于使用底部概念扩展的 DL ELHI,我们提供了固定参数易处理的 OMQ 类的特征。对于使用域和范围限制扩展的片段 EL 以及底部概念(限制反向角色的使用),我们提供了在组合复杂性中易于处理的 OMQ 类的特征。这两个结果都与有界树宽的 OMQ 等效,并基于参数化复杂性理论的合理假设。它们在精神上类似于 Grohe 对关系数据库上的连接查询的易处理类别的开创性特征。我们进一步研究了决定给定 OMQ 是否等同于有界树宽的 OMQ 的元问题的复杂性,提供了从 NP 到 2ExpTime 的几个完整性结果,具体取决于所使用的 DL。我们还考虑了 DL-Lite DL 系列,包括承认功能角色的成员。我们提供了在组合复杂性中易于处理的 OMQ 类的特征。这两个结果都与有界树宽的 OMQ 等效,并基于参数化复杂性理论的合理假设。它们在精神上类似于 Grohe 对关系数据库上的连接查询的易处理类别的开创性特征。我们进一步研究了决定给定 OMQ 是否等同于有界树宽的 OMQ 的元问题的复杂性,提供了从 NP 到 2ExpTime 的几个完整性结果,具体取决于所使用的 DL。我们还考虑了 DL-Lite DL 系列,包括承认功能角色的成员。我们提供了在组合复杂性中易于处理的 OMQ 类的特征。这两个结果都与有界树宽的 OMQ 等效,并基于参数化复杂性理论的合理假设。它们在精神上类似于 Grohe 对关系数据库上的连接查询的易处理类别的开创性特征。我们进一步研究了决定给定 OMQ 是否等同于有界树宽的 OMQ 的元问题的复杂性,提供了从 NP 到 2ExpTime 的几个完整性结果,具体取决于所使用的 DL。我们还考虑了 DL-Lite DL 系列,包括承认功能角色的成员。这两个结果都与有界树宽的 OMQ 等效,并基于参数化复杂性理论的合理假设。它们在精神上类似于 Grohe 对关系数据库上的连接查询的易处理类别的开创性特征。我们进一步研究了决定给定 OMQ 是否等同于有界树宽的 OMQ 的元问题的复杂性,提供了从 NP 到 2ExpTime 的几个完整性结果,具体取决于所使用的 DL。我们还考虑了 DL-Lite DL 系列,包括承认功能角色的成员。这两个结果都与有界树宽的 OMQ 等效,并基于参数化复杂性理论的合理假设。它们在精神上类似于 Grohe 对关系数据库上的连接查询的易处理类别的开创性特征。我们进一步研究了决定给定 OMQ 是否等同于有界树宽的 OMQ 的元问题的复杂性,提供了从 NP 到 2ExpTime 的几个完整性结果,具体取决于所使用的 DL。我们还考虑了 DL-Lite DL 系列,包括承认功能角色的成员。我们进一步研究了决定给定 OMQ 是否等同于有界树宽的 OMQ 的元问题的复杂性,提供了从 NP 到 2ExpTime 的几个完整性结果,具体取决于所使用的 DL。我们还考虑了 DL-Lite DL 系列,包括承认功能角色的成员。我们进一步研究了决定给定 OMQ 是否等同于有界树宽的 OMQ 的元问题的复杂性,提供了从 NP 到 2ExpTime 的几个完整性结果,具体取决于所使用的 DL。我们还考虑了 DL-Lite DL 系列,包括承认功能角色的成员。
更新日期:2020-07-30
down
wechat
bug